用“,”这个字符将多个数组拼接成一个字符串;
时间: 2024-01-22 07:17:38 浏览: 23
可以使用 Python 中的 join() 方法来将多个数组拼接成一个字符串。这个方法需要指定一个分隔符,即每个数组之间的连接符。
例如,将三个数组拼接成一个用逗号分隔的字符串:
```python
arr1 = ['apple', 'banana', 'orange']
arr2 = ['red', 'yellow', 'orange']
arr3 = ['juicy', 'sweet', 'tangy']
# 用逗号连接三个数组
result = ','.join(arr1 + arr2 + arr3)
print(result) # 输出:apple,banana,orange,red,yellow,orange,juicy,sweet,tangy
```
相关问题
在PHP,用“,”这个字符将多个数组拼接成一个字符串;
在PHP中,可以使用implode()函数将多个数组拼接成一个字符串。具体语法如下:
```php
implode(separator, array)
```
其中,separator参数表示要用来分隔数组元素的字符串,array参数表示要拼接的数组。
例如,将一个包含三个元素的数组拼接成一个字符串,以逗号作为分隔符,可以使用以下代码:
```php
$array = array('apple', 'banana', 'orange');
$str = implode(',', $array);
echo $str; // 输出:apple,banana,orange
```
注意,implode()函数的第一个参数separator是可选的,如果省略,则默认使用空字符串作为分隔符。
shell 字符串与多个字符串数组变量拼接成字符串
可以使用拼接符号 `+` 来将多个字符串拼接成一个字符串。例如:
```bash
string1="hello"
string2="world"
result=$string1$string2
echo $result
```
输出结果为:`helloworld`
如果要将多个字符串数组变量拼接成一个字符串,可以使用循环遍历数组并拼接。例如:
```bash
array1=("hello" "world")
array2=("how" "are" "you")
result=""
for i in "${array1[@]}" "${array2[@]}"; do
result="$result$i"
done
echo $result
```
输出结果为:`helloworldhowareyou`